Now a few other notes.
Maybe it is just me, but on page 8 I have no idea what is meant by
The Selector ID term is in sync with the selectorId
Information Element, specified in the PSAMP Protocol
[RFC5476].
7.1.8. p2pTechnology
7.1.9. tunnelTechnology
7.1.10. encryptedTechnology
specify y, 2, n, 2, u, and 0 in addition to the "yes", "no", and
"unassigned" values found at http://www.iana.org/assignments/ipfix/ipfix.xml
Are all of these valid values? If yes should the IANA entries be updated?
